Chess is fun and can be learned quickly and easily. Studies have found that chess improves test results in reading, science, and math, and encourages growth in critical cognitive skills. Beyond academia, chess influences social behavior, including self esteem, respect for others, patience, and good sportsmanship. Students at all levels of skill are welcome!

The Berkeley Chess School (BCS) is a nonprofit organization offering chess instruction from elementary through high school since 1982. We are an affiliate of the US Chess Federation. Over the years our students have won numerous state championships, with some going on to become Masters, FIDE Masters and International Masters.
